Maintaining Air High Quality During Restoration



Health and wellness are leading priorities for families in Campbell, especially those with children or pets. Traditional sanding can launch irritants that linger in the a/c system for months, potentially setting off allergies or respiratory concerns. A dust-free strategy uses HEPA filtering to trap tiny bits that would otherwise bypass conventional vacuum bags. This indicates you can typically stay in your home while the job is being carried out without worrying about the air you take a breath. Because the dirt is included and transported to a closed system outside the home, the risk of cross-contamination in between areas is essentially eliminated. This level of sanitation is a game-changer for contemporary home upkeep, allowing for a premium upgrade without the common mess of a building and construction zone.

The Completing Touch and Long Life



The final stage of any type of reconstruction is the application of the protective layer. Whether you choose a matte look or a high-gloss sparkle, the atmosphere needs to be completely clean for the coating to bond properly. Even a little quantity of lingering dust can create "nibs" or tiny bumps in the wet finish, bring about a harsh structure once it dries. By utilizing a dust-free system, the air remains still and clear, permitting the sealer to level out completely. This produces a durable obstacle that secures against the foot website traffic of a hectic rural way of living. Safeguarding Your Investment for the Future



Once your floors are recovered, maintaining them in leading shape is fairly easy. The trick is to take care of the grit and moisture that can go into from the exterior. Positioning high-quality floor coverings at entranceways is a fantastic way to capture the sand and soil that imitate sandpaper on your new surface. Considering that our regional atmosphere can get quite dirty throughout the completely dry period, a quick pass with a microfiber wipe one or two times a week will keep the surface area looking fresh. Prevent utilizing too much water when cleaning, as the wood in our region is sensitive to moisture variations. Instead, use cleansers particularly formulated for your specific coating.
